SUMMARY:“Shivers” – Three Supernatural Tales of Tantramar\, by Andrew Ennals – 7 pm and 9 pm
DESCRIPTION:“Shivers” – Three Supernatural Tales of Tantramar\, by Andrew Ennals – 7 pm and 9 pm\nOctober 27 \n\n\nAn abandoned fiddle comes to life. Mysterious ghosts haunt a group of university students. And a long-lost legend emerges from the foggy Tantramar Marsh more terrifying than ever. In Live Bait Theatre’s world premiere of SHIVERS: 3 Tales of Supernatural Tantramar by Andrew Ennals\, three of the area’s many spooky stories are brought to the stage. Mixing humour with history and genuine scares\, SHIVERS is a local treat just in time for Hallowe’en. \nPlaying October 26 at 7 pm\, and October 27 and 28 at 7 pm and 9 pm at the Performers Studio at 3 Fairfield Rd. SUMMARY:J.E.A. Crake Concert – Echo Chamber performs “A World Transformed”
DESCRIPTION:Created and performed by the Toronto-based Echo Chamber ensemble\, “A World Transformed” is a reflection on the hate-crime murder of Matthew Shepard. Contemporary dance\, music (voices\, piano\, violin)\, and spoken word are used to explore this pivotal story through the lens of Matthew and his mother\, Judy Shepard\, who remains one of today’s leading voices fighting for 2SLGBTQ+ rights. The program expresses both deep grief and a hopeful belief in the power of individuals to bring about positive change in the world. \nThis performance is the 14th annual J.E.A.
